# Received debits Authorize and manage third-party-initiated debits. You can authorize third parties to debit funds from a financial account. Any transaction initiated after this authorization generates a [ReceivedDebit](https://docs.stripe.com/api/v2/money-management/received-debits/object.md?api-version=preview) object on the financial account, detailing how funds were sent and from what account, where possible. Stripe supports the following types of externally-initiated debits: | Debit type | Description | | --- | --- | | Card spending | Spending money on a card through [Stripe Issuing](https://docs.stripe.com/issuing/purchases/transactions.md#transactions) | | ACH debit1 | Pulling money from a financial account into an external account using ACH debits | | Direct debit 2 | Pulling money from a financial account into an external account using direct debits | | Top-up | Pulling money from a platform’s financial account into that platform’s Stripe payments balance using [top-ups](https://docs.stripe.com/treasury/connect/v2/moving-money/fund-a-financial-account.md#transfer-to-other-balance). | 1 Available in the US only. [Contact support to request access](https://support.stripe.com/contact) ## Manage mandates Available in: GB When a third party initiates a debit from a financial account for the first time, Stripe creates a `ReceivedDebitMandate` representing authorization for the third party to initiate such debits and sends the `v2.money_management.received_debit_mandate.created` webhook event. When you make API calls to manage mandates on behalf of a connected account, specify the connected account’s ID in the `Stripe-Account` header. ### Retrieve a mandate You can retrieve the mandate using the ID from the webhook event to review the details of the debit request and validate its legitimacy. ```curl curl https://api.stripe.com/v2/money_management/received_debit_mandates/{{RECEIVED_DEBIT_MANDATE_ID}} \ -H "Authorization: Bearer <>" \ -H "Stripe-Version: 2026-07-29.preview" \ -H "Stripe-Account: {{CONNECTEDACCOUNT_ID}}" ``` The response includes information about the initiating party. If you don’t cancel the mandate within one day of its creation, Stripe schedules the associated debit and sends the `v2.money_management.received_debit.scheduled` webhook event. ```json { "id": "rdm_1234", "object": "v2.money_management.received_debit_mandate", "livemode": false, "financial_account": identifier("financialAccountId"), "type": "bank_transfer", "currency": "gbp", "bank_transfer": { "network": "bacs", "account_holder_name" : "Rocket Rides", "reference": "R/1234", "financial_address": "{{FINANCIAL_ADDRESS_ID}}" }, "status": "active", "status_transitions": { "created_at": "2026-04-26T23:12:35.952Z", "activated_at": "2026-04-26T23:12:35.952Z" } } ``` Any subsequent debits from the third party authorized by the mandate automatically generate a `ReceivedDebit` with `scheduled` status. ### Cancel a mandate You can cancel a mandate to end debit authorization at any time. Canceling while an upcoming debit is still `scheduled` prevents that debit from completing and also prevents any future debits from the third party without a new mandate authorization. > #### Individual debits > > You can’t cancel or decline a scheduled received debit without canceling the mandate. ```curl curl -X POST https://api.stripe.com/v2/money_management/received_debit_mandates/{{RECEIVED_DEBIT_MANDATE_ID}}/cancel \ -H "Authorization: Bearer <>" \ -H "Stripe-Version: 2026-07-29.preview" \ -H "Stripe-Account: {{CONNECTEDACCOUNT_ID}}" ``` The response confirms the mandate is `pending_cancellation`. After the cancellation completes, Stripe sends the `v2.money_management.received_debit_mandate.canceled` webhook event signaling the transition to `canceled`. ### List mandates You can retrieve the set of mandates in place for a connected account. Use inline parameters, such as `status=active`, to filter the results. ```curl curl https://api.stripe.com/v2/money_management/received_debit_mandates \ -H "Authorization: Bearer <>" \ -H "Stripe-Version: 2026-07-29.preview" \ -H "Stripe-Account: {{CONNECTEDACCOUNT_ID}}" ``` The result includes information about each mandate’s originator and when they created it, its status and type, and the financial account it applies to. ```json { "data": [ { "id": "rdm_test_61UxLhI8gPhKNsOwu16Ux87t0BE9ZVFsBHMMih6wSNPM", "object": "v2.money_management.received_debit_mandate", "bank_transfer": { "account_holder_name": "Test Originator", "financial_address": "{{FINANCIAL_ADDRESS_ID}}", "network": "bacs", "reference": "R/1234" }, "created": "2026-06-30T09:14:00.475Z", "currency": "gbp", "financial_account": identifier("financialAccountId"), "status": "active", "status_details": null, "status_transitions": { "activated_at": "2026-06-30T09:14:00.475Z", "canceled_at": null, "created_at": "2026-06-30T09:14:00.475Z", "expired_at": null, "pending_cancellation_at": null }, "type": "bank_transfer", "livemode": false } ] } ``` ## Monitor received debits Available in: GB, US After you authorize a third party’s mandate to directly debit a financial account, you can review received debits as they occur and dispute them if necessary. Listen for [events](https://docs.stripe.com/treasury/connect/v2/moving-money/received-debits.md#webhooks) related to received debit activity and handle them accordingly. ### Retrieve a received debit [Retrieve a received debit](https://docs.stripe.com/api/v2/money-management/received-debits/retrieve.md?api-version=preview) by its ID to review details such as the `amount`, `status`, and `type` of transfer. ```curl curl https://api.stripe.com/v2/money_management/received_debits/{{RECEIVED_DEBIT_ID}} \ -H "Authorization: Bearer <>" \ -H "Stripe-Version: 2026-06-24.preview" \ -H "Stripe-Context: {{CONTEXT_ID}}" ``` ```json { "id": "rd_123", "object": "v2.money_management.received_debit", "amount": { "value": 500, "currency": "usd" }, "bank_transfer": { "financial_address": "{{FINANCIAL_ADDRESS_ID}}", "payment_method_type": "us_bank_account", "statement_descriptor": "Some statement descriptor", "us_bank_account": { "bank_name": "US BANK NAME", "network": "ach", "routing_number": "110000000" } }, "created": "2026-05-28T08:21:19.751Z", "description": "Some description", "dispute_details": { "debit_dispute": null, "dispute_window_closes_at": "2026-05-30T01:45:00.000Z" }, "financial_account": identifier("financialAccountId"), "receipt_url": "https://payments.stripe.com/transaction_receipt/session_123", "status": "succeeded", "status_details": null, "status_transitions": { "canceled_at": null, "failed_at": null, "succeeded_at": "2026-05-28T08:21:19.751Z" }, "type": "bank_transfer", "livemode": false } ``` ### List received debits [List received debits](https://docs.stripe.com/api/v2/money-management/received-debits/list.md?api-version=preview) to review debit transactions for a financial account. Use parameters in the request to limit responses or filter results by created date. UK users can also filter by a specific `received_debit_mandate`. ```curl curl https://api.stripe.com/v2/money_management/received_debits \ -H "Authorization: Bearer <>" \ -H "Stripe-Version: 2026-06-24.preview" \ -H "Stripe-Context: {{CONTEXT_ID}}" ``` ## Dispute a received debit > The Debit Disputes API doesn’t support disputing a Bacs GBP direct debit. You must [contact support](https://support.stripe.com/contact) to initiate these disputes. You can dispute a `ReceivedDebit` within the dispute window specified in `dispute_details.dispute_window_closes_at`. Create a [DebitDispute](https://docs.stripe.com/api/v2/money-management/debit-disputes/object.md?api-version=preview) to initiate the dispute process. ```curl curl -X POST https://api.stripe.com/v2/money_management/debit_disputes \ -H "Authorization: Bearer <>" \ -H "Stripe-Version: 2026-06-24.preview" \ -H "Stripe-Context: {{CONTEXT_ID}}" \ --json '{ "received_debit": "{{RECEIVED_DEBIT_ID}}", "bank_transfer": { "reason": "unauthorized" } }' ``` ### Retrieve a debit dispute [Retrieve a debit dispute](https://docs.stripe.com/api/v2/money-management/debit-disputes/retrieve.md?api-version=preview) by its ID to check its status. ```curl curl https://api.stripe.com/v2/money_management/debit_disputes/{{DEBIT_DISPUTE_ID}} \ -H "Authorization: Bearer <>" \ -H "Stripe-Version: 2026-06-24.preview" \ -H "Stripe-Context: {{CONTEXT_ID}}" ``` ### List debit disputes [List debit disputes](https://docs.stripe.com/api/v2/money-management/debit-disputes/list.md?api-version=preview) to review all disputes for a financial account. Use parameters in the request to limit responses or filter results by `status` or `financial_account`. ```curl curl https://api.stripe.com/v2/money_management/debit_disputes \ -H "Authorization: Bearer <>" \ -H "Stripe-Version: 2026-06-24.preview" \ -H "Stripe-Context: {{CONTEXT_ID}}" ``` ## Test received debits `ReceivedDebit` objects represent real direct debits initiated by a third party against a financial address. Because third parties initiate them, you can’t create them through the API in live mode. Use the [debit test helper](https://docs.stripe.com/api/v2/money-management/test-helpers/financial-addresses/debit.md?api-version=preview) to simulate a `ReceivedDebit` in a sandbox so you can verify that your integration handles incoming debits correctly. You can trigger a failed debit by making sure the financial account has an insufficient balance for the test payment. If you simulate a Bacs GBP debit, the helper also creates a `ReceivedDebitMandate`. ```curl curl -X POST https://api.stripe.com/v2/money_management/test_helpers/financial_addresses/{{FINANCIAL_ADDRESS_ID}}/debit \ -H "Authorization: Bearer <>" \ -H "Stripe-Version: 2026-06-24.preview" \ -H "Stripe-Context: {{CONTEXT_ID}}" \ --json '{ "amount": { "value": 101, "currency": "usd" }, "statement_descriptor": "my descriptor", "network": "ach" }' ``` A successful response confirms the simulation was accepted: ```json { "object": "v2.money_management.financial_address_debit_simulation", "status": "accepted", "livemode": false } ``` ## Webhooks Listen for the following `v2.money_management` events to track and handle status changes related to received debits and associated disputes. | Event | Description | | --- | --- | | `received_debit_mandate.created` | A third party initiated a first debit and triggered creation of a mandate. | | `received_debit_mandate.canceled` | A received debit mandate is canceled, preventing further debits authorized by that mandate. | | `received_debit.scheduled` | A received debit is scheduled, but hasn’t debited the financial account yet. | | `received_debit.pending` | A received debit related to Issuing card spend is pending, but hasn’t debited the financial account yet. | | `received_debit.succeeded` | A received debit succeeds. | | `received_debit.failed` | A received debit fails. | | `received_debit.canceled` | A received debit related to Issuing card spend is canceled. | | `received_debit.updated` | A received debit is updated. | | `debit_dispute.submitted` | A debit dispute is submitted. | | `debit_dispute.succeeded` | A debit dispute succeeds. | | `debit_dispute.failed` | A debit dispute fails. |
